[Echographic evaluation of the thyroid gland and urinary iodine concentration in school children from various regions of the State of São Paulo, Brazil].

Abstract

We have examined, by ultrasonographic studies, the thyroid gland of 844 schoolchildren, aged between 6 and 14 years old (423 girls, 421 boys). There was a progressive increase of the thyroid volume with aging with a positive and significant correlation with the body surface area. The presence of enlarged thyroid gland was rarely seen, being present in only 1.6% of the studied cohort. A few thyroid gland abnormalities were noticed such as hemiagenesia (4 children), nodules and cysts and hypoechogenicity (total: 1.4% of all subjects examined). It was clearly demonstrated that the urinary excretion of iodine was elevated being above 300 microg Iodine/L in 53% of the schoolchildren examined. Assays for the iodine concentration in the domestic salt samples revealed values between 28.1 and 63.3 mgI/kg of salt. We concluded that the schoolchildren population of the State of São Paulo may be under an excessive daily ingestion of iodine. This may induce, if extrapolated to the general population, subclinical hyperthyroidism in the elderly and possibly an increment in the prevalence of chronic autoimmune thyroiditis.
